An investment earning interest at the rate of 10%, compounded continuously, will double in t years. Find t. Use the formula , wh

ere is the amount after t years, is the initial amount, r is the rate of interest, and t is the time. t = years.

Mathematics
1 answer:
Andre45 [30]3 years ago
8 0

Answer:

I have attached the formula solved for years (or time).

We'll say principal = 100 and total = 200

Years = ln (200 / 100) / .1

Years = ln (2) / .1

Years = 0.69314718056 / .1

Years = 6.9314718056

What is the value of k used to find the coordinates of a point that partitions a segment into a ratio of 5:3. Please Explain.
Dafna11 [192]

Answer:

The value of k is 5/8

Step-by-step explanation:

The value of k is found by dividing the numerator of the original ratio, 5, by the sum of the numerator and denominator of the ratio

When finding a point, P, to partition a line segment AB into the ratio a/b, we find a ratio c = a / (a + b)

According to this formula we find the value of k.

k = a/(a+b)

where a = 5

b = 3

Now plug the values in the formula:

k = 5/(5+3)

k = 5/8 ....
